love ke70 Posted January 8, 2011 Report Posted January 8, 2011 ive always done it with the box, get everything undone, lift it with an engine crane, have a helper to push and wiggle and tilt the motor box, remember to remove the bonnet, and you will get it pretty easy :) Quote
bAKER Posted January 8, 2011 Report Posted January 8, 2011 ive always done it with the box, get everything undone, lift it with an engine crane, have a helper to push and wiggle and tilt the motor box, remember to remove the bonnet, and you will get it pretty easy :) this. Quote
ke70dave Posted January 8, 2011 Report Posted January 8, 2011 not sure why you guys removing the bonnet for.. just make sure the end of your crane is close to the engine, don't have 1m of chain between chain and engine. and yeah its like a 30min job to remove a 4k engine from a ke70. gbox xmember/engine xmember, few fuel lines, exhaust, few wires....out it comes.
